En el mundo de la programación, la elección de un editor de texto adecuado puede marcar una gran diferencia en la productividad y eficiencia. Los editores de texto son herramientas fundamentales para los programadores, ya que les permite escribir, modificar y depurar código de manera eficiente. Con una amplia gama de opciones disponibles en el mercado, es crucial elegir el que mejor se adapte a las necesidades individuales y al flujo de trabajo. Este artículo explora algunos de los editores de texto gratuitos más útiles para programadores y ofrece una visión general de sus características principales.
Hoy en día, la mayoría de los programadores buscan editores que no solo sean gratuitos, sino que también ofrezcan funcionalidades avanzadas como el resaltado de sintaxis, la integración con sistemas de control de versiones y la compatibilidad con diversos lenguajes de programación. Entre las opciones destacadas se encuentran editores con capacidades extensibles y personalizables que pueden adaptarse a diferentes estilos de programación y entornos de desarrollo. A continuación, exploraremos las mejores opciones disponibles, considerando también el tipo de hardware que puede complementar estas herramientas.
Recomendaciones de hardware para programadores
En principio, antes de pensar en el software, es importante mencionar que el equipo con el que se trabaja también influye en la experiencia de programación. Por lo tanto, la elección del hardware también es importante cuando se trabaja con editores de texto y otras herramientas de desarrollo. Una laptop Matebook 13 puede ser una excelente opción debido a su equilibrio entre rendimiento y portabilidad. Otros modelos similares incluyen:
Dell XPS 13: Ofrece una combinación de rendimiento y diseño compacto.
MacBook Air: Conocida por su rendimiento y portabilidad, ideal para programadores que prefieren el ecosistema de Apple.
Lenovo ThinkPad X1 Carbon: Destacada por su durabilidad y teclado cómodo, adecuado para largas sesiones de programación.
Cada uno de estos modelos puede proporcionar un entorno adecuado para ejecutar editores de texto y otras aplicaciones de desarrollo.
Los editores de texto más recomendados para programadores
Ahora sí, teniendo la computadora adecuada para trabajar, procedemos a contarte cuáles son los editores de texto más convenientes:
Visual Studio Code
Visual Studio Code es uno de los editores de texto más populares entre los programadores. Este editor, desarrollado por Microsoft, ofrece una amplia gama de funcionalidades que lo hacen ideal para diversos lenguajes de programación. Entre sus características más destacadas se encuentran:
Extensiones: Permite agregar una gran variedad de extensiones que amplían sus capacidades.
Integración con Git: Ofrece herramientas integradas para el control de versiones.
Depuración: Incluye potentes herramientas de depuración.
Su compatibilidad con múltiples sistemas operativos y su gran comunidad de usuarios contribuyen a su popularidad. Visual Studio Code es una excelente opción para aquellos que buscan un editor flexible y extensible.
Atom
Atom es otro editor de texto ampliamente utilizado, desarrollado por GitHub. Conocido por su interfaz amigable y su alta personalización, Atom es ideal para programadores que valoran un entorno de trabajo adaptado a sus preferencias. Sus características principales incluyen:
Interfaz personalizable: Permite modificar la apariencia y funcionalidad del editor según las necesidades del usuario.
Soporte para múltiples lenguajes: Ofrece soporte para diversos lenguajes de programación mediante paquetes adicionales.
Integración de Git y GitHub: Facilita el trabajo con sistemas de control de versiones.
Atom es particularmente adecuado para aquellos que buscan un editor que se pueda adaptar a sus requisitos específicos.
Sublime Text
Sublime Text es conocido por su velocidad y rendimiento. Aunque no es completamente gratuito, su versión de prueba ofrece muchas funcionalidades que pueden ser suficientes para muchos usuarios. Entre sus características destacadas se encuentran:
Velocidad y eficiencia: Ofrece una experiencia de edición rápida y fluida.
Minimización de distracciones: Su diseño está enfocado en mantener al usuario concentrado en el código.
Paleta de comandos: Proporciona una manera rápida de acceder a diversas funciones del editor.
Es una opción valiosa para programadores que buscan un editor rápido y eficiente sin comprometer demasiado los recursos del sistema.
Notepad++
Notepad++ es un editor de texto ligero y altamente eficiente, popular entre programadores que buscan una herramienta sencilla pero potente. Sus características principales incluyen:
Soporte para múltiples lenguajes: Ofrece resaltado de sintaxis para una amplia gama de lenguajes de programación.
Interfaz simple: Su diseño minimalista facilita la navegación y la edición.
Plugins: Permite la instalación de plugins para agregar funcionalidades adicionales.
Notepad++ es ideal para aquellos que necesitan un editor rápido y fácil de usar sin complicaciones adicionales. Su naturaleza gratuita y su enfoque en la simplicidad lo convierten en una opción atractiva para programadores que buscan eficiencia sin necesidad de características avanzadas.
Brackets
Brackets es un editor de texto de código abierto desarrollado por Adobe, centrado en el desarrollo web. Sus características clave incluyen:
Vista previa en vivo: Permite ver los cambios en el navegador en tiempo real mientras se edita el código.
Edición rápida de código: Ofrece herramientas para editar CSS y HTML de manera rápida y eficiente.
Extensiones: Soporta una amplia gama de extensiones que mejoran su funcionalidad.
Brackets es particularmente útil para desarrolladores web que buscan una experiencia integrada con capacidades de vista previa en vivo. Su enfoque en el desarrollo web y sus herramientas específicas para este ámbito lo hacen una excelente opción para este tipo de proyectos.
CoffeeCup HTML Editor
CoffeeCup HTML Editor es una herramienta enfocada en el desarrollo de páginas web, ofreciendo tanto una versión gratuita como una de pago con funcionalidades adicionales. Sus características incluyen:
Editor visual y de código: Permite alternar entre la vista de diseño visual y el código.
Plantillas predefinidas: Incluye una variedad de plantillas para facilitar la creación de sitios web.
Soporte para múltiples lenguajes: Ofrece herramientas de edición para HTML, CSS y otros lenguajes relacionados.
El CoffeeCup HTML Editor es una opción útil para desarrolladores que buscan una herramienta con opciones visuales y de código para la creación de sitios web. Su combinación de características lo hace adecuado para una variedad de tareas en el desarrollo web.
Conclusión
Elegir el editor de texto adecuado es fundamental para cualquier programador que busque mejorar su productividad y eficiencia. Entre las opciones gratuitas más útiles se encuentran Visual Studio Code, Atom y Sublime Text, cada uno con sus propias características y ventajas. Además, contar con una laptop Matebook 13 o un modelo similar puede complementar la experiencia de desarrollo, proporcionando un rendimiento óptimo y una experiencia de usuario fluida. Evaluar las características del editor y el hardware con el que se trabaja puede hacer una gran diferencia en el trabajo diario de programación.
Preguntas frecuentes
¿Cuál es el mejor editor de texto para programar?
El mejor editor de texto para programar depende de las necesidades individuales, pero Visual Studio Code es altamente recomendado por su flexibilidad, extensiones y soporte para múltiples lenguajes.
¿Cuáles son los 3 editores de textos más usados?
Los tres editores de texto más usados son Visual Studio Code, Sublime Text y Atom. Cada uno ofrece características avanzadas y extensiones que se adaptan a diferentes estilos de programación. Visual Studio Code es el más popular por su versatilidad y extensibilidad.